side
noun
/saɪd/

Definition
A particular surface or part of something that is usually flat or has a distinct edge.

Examples
- She stood by my side during the difficult times.
- The box has six sides.
- Let’s explore the other side of the argument.

Meaning
The term ‘side’ refers to a position, aspect, or boundary of an object or concept.

Synonyms
- flank
- aspect
- facet
- border
